The Slaughterhouse in Tucson, Arizona, is a renowned haunted attraction with a rich history and reputation for intense paranormal activity.
Historical Background
Originally constructed in the 1950s, The Slaughterhouse functioned as a meatpacking plant until its closure in the 1970s. The building remained abandoned for decades, during which it garnered a reputation for eerie occurrences and ghostly sightings. In 2004, the facility was transformed into a haunted attraction, preserving its industrial architecture to enhance the chilling ambiance.
Reported Paranormal Activity
Visitors and staff have reported numerous unsettling experiences, including disembodied screams, footsteps, and whispers. Some have felt unseen entities tugging at their clothing, while others have detected sudden drops in temperature and the smell of rotting flesh.
The venue gained national attention when it was featured on the Travel Channel’s “Ghost Adventures,” where investigators documented violent scratches and other unexplained phenomena.

Scare Rating
Based on visitor testimonials and national rankings, The Slaughterhouse is considered one of the most intense haunted attractions in the United States. It was rated the #1 haunted house in the country by Scurryface in 2021 and continues to receive high praise for its elaborate sets and terrifying experiences.
Additional Legends and Visitor Experiences
Beyond the orchestrated scares, The Slaughterhouse’s history as a former meatpacking plant contributes to its haunted lore. Some visitors claim to have encountered apparitions of former workers and have experienced unexplained phenomena during their visits. The combination of its dark past and modern horror elements makes it a unique destination for thrill-seekers and paranormal enthusiasts alike.
